c# winform 读取oracle中blob字段图片并且显示到picturebox里,保存进库

c# winform 读取oracle中blob字段图片并且显示到picturebox里,保存进库

ID:20149560

大小:118.00 KB

页数:6页

时间:2018-10-09

c# winform 读取oracle中blob字段图片并且显示到picturebox里,保存进库_第1页
c# winform 读取oracle中blob字段图片并且显示到picturebox里,保存进库_第2页
c# winform 读取oracle中blob字段图片并且显示到picturebox里,保存进库_第3页
c# winform 读取oracle中blob字段图片并且显示到picturebox里,保存进库_第4页
c# winform 读取oracle中blob字段图片并且显示到picturebox里,保存进库_第5页
资源描述:

《c# winform 读取oracle中blob字段图片并且显示到picturebox里,保存进库》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、1.private void button2_Click(object sender, EventArgs e)  2.{  3.    OracleConnection conn = dbc.getConnection();//获得conn连接  4.    try  5.    {  6.        conn.Open();  7.        OracleCommand cmd = conn.CreateCommand();  8.        cmd.CommandText = "S

2、ELECT zp FROM kk.kkbj WHERE xh = 2345 ";//查询获得图片流  9.  10.        OracleDataReader reader = cmd.ExecuteReader();//创建一个OracleDateReader对象   11.        reader.Read();  12.  13.        MemoryStream ms = new MemoryStream((byte[])reader["zp"]);  14.  15.   

3、     Image image = Image.FromStream(ms, true);  16.  17.        reader.Close();  18.        conn.Close();  19.  20.        pictureBox1.Image = image;  21.    }  22.    catch (Exception ee)  23.    {  24.        MessageBox.Show(ee.Message.ToString());  

4、25.    }  26.  27.}  privatevoidbutton2_Click(objectsender,EventArgse){OracleConnectionconn=dbc.getConnection();//获得conn连接try{conn.Open();OracleCommandcmd=conn.CreateCommand();cmd.CommandText="SELECTzpFROMkk.kkbjWHERExh=2345";//查询获得图片流OracleDataReaderr

5、eader=cmd.ExecuteReader();//创建一个OracleDateReader对象reader.Read();MemoryStreamms=newMemoryStream((byte[])reader["zp"]);Imageimage=Image.FromStream(ms,true);reader.Close();conn.Close();pictureBox1.Image=image;}catch(Exceptionee){MessageBox.Show(ee.Message

6、.ToString());}}----------下边是上传和存入数据库有asp.net和winform(转)----------------------------------本文总结如何在.NetWinform和.Netwebform(asp.net)中将图片存入sqlserver中并读取显示的方法   1,使用asp.net将图片上传并存入SqlServer中,然后从SqlServer中读取并显示出来   一,上传并存入SqlServer   数据库结构createtabletest{    

7、ididentity(1,1),    FImageimage}   相关的存储过程CreateprocUpdateImage(    @UpdateImageImage)AsInsertIntotest(FImage)values(@UpdateImage)GO   在UpPhoto.aspx文件中添加如下:C#代码 1.  2.

8、 name="btnAdd" runat="server" Text="上传">     然后在后置代码文件UpPhoto.aspx.cs添加btnAdd按钮的单击事件处理代码:C#代码

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。